帝国CMS灵动标签如何调用模板变量?

   2024-05-28 22:15:55  
在帝国CMS中,灵动标签是一种非常强大的自定义模板标签,它允许开发者通过编写简单的脚本来扩展系统的功能,使用灵动标签可以方便地调用模板变量,实现页面的动态内容展示,以下是如何在帝国CMS中使用灵动标签调用模板变量的详细步骤:

帝国cms灵动标签如何调用模板变量
(图片来源网络,侵删)

1. 理解模板变量

在开始之前,首先需要理解什么是模板变量,在帝国CMS中,模板变量是用于保存内容的占位符,它们通常在模板文件中定义,并可以在后台管理界面中进行修改和设置,一个模板变量可能代表网站的标题、关键词或描述等。

2. 创建模板变量

在后台管理界面中,进入“系统管理” > “模板管理” > “模板变量管理”,在这里可以添加、编辑或删除模板变量,创建模板变量时,需要为其指定一个唯一的标识符(如{Saivi:Title}),这个标识符将用于在模板文件中引用该变量。

3. 使用灵动标签调用模板变量

在模板文件中,可以使用灵动标签来调用这些模板变量,灵动标签的基本语法如下:

{Saivi:LabelName var='变量名'}

LabelName是你要调用的标签名称,var属性用于指定要调用的模板变量名。

4. 示例

假设你已经创建了一个名为title的模板变量,现在你想在首页的标题位置显示这个变量的内容,可以按照以下步骤操作:

步骤1:确保模板变量已创建

在后台管理界面中,确认title模板变量已经创建,并为其设置了合适的值。

步骤2:在模板文件中使用灵动标签

打开首页的模板文件,找到标题所在的HTML元素,然后插入灵动标签:

<h1>{Saivi:LabelName var='title'}</h1>

这里,LabelName应该替换为你实际使用的标签名称,如果你使用的是默认的Label标签,那么代码应该是:

<h1>{Saivi:Label var='title'}</h1>

步骤3:预览效果

保存模板文件后,刷新前台页面查看效果,如果一切设置正确,你应该能在页面上看到title模板变量的内容。

5. 注意事项

确保模板文件的编码格式与系统设置一致,避免因编码问题导致乱码。

在使用灵动标签时,要注意标签的嵌套规则,避免出现错误的输出。

如果需要对模板变量的内容进行格式化或处理,可以在灵动标签中使用内置的函数或自定义的脚本来实现。

归纳

通过上述步骤,你已经学会了如何在帝国CMS中使用灵动标签调用模板变量,这一功能为模板设计提供了极大的灵活性,使得网站内容的管理更加便捷和高效,记得在实际使用时,结合帝国CMS的其他功能和标签,可以创造出更加丰富和个性化的网站页面。



声明:本文系互联网搜索百度而收集整理,不以盈利性为目的,文字、图文资料源于互联网且共享于互联网。
如有侵权,请联系 hzy98999#qq.com (#改@) 删除。